    I have an old set of ideas for a werewolf overhaul, so I'll paste the ones relevant to werebear :)
    Spoiler:  
    Show

    - Werebear has more tanky stats than werewolf, runs a little slower. More health, less stamina regen. More frost resist, more fire weakness.
            - Sprinting knocks back enemies you run into. (maybe put this in a perk?)
            - New totems for werebear skills
                - Primal Roar ; enemies flee (or cower in fear in place) for 10 seconds, increase stamina regen for the duration.
                - Totem of Ironfur ; roar sharply increases armor (magic resistance too?) and gives reflect melee damage for the duration.
                - Totem of the Beast ; roar causes enemies to drop their weapons, and breaks nearby locks up to expert difficulty.
                - Totem of the Woods ; roar sharply increases health and stamina regeneration, and nearby predators come to your aid.
                - Totem of Thorns ; roar causes sharp thorns to sprout from your skin, impaling enemies that you come into contact with (close-range high damage cloak spell, synergizes well with a knockdown-and-maul playstyle)
                Bear totems can be found in (radiant?) dungeon locations. Find them and
                bring them to Snowclad Ruins, then you can pray to choose a totem.

    - Human-form bonuses depending on were-type
            - Apart from disease immunity and weakness to silver weapons in human form...
                For werebears, plus stamina, health, and armor in human form.
                For werewolves, plus stamina, stamina regen, and movement speed in human form.
    - Werebears Roar, as opposed to werewolf Howl.
    - Remove sprint lunge attack from werebears (and give a sprint knockdown instead)
    - (Unmarked?) quest to gather Ursine Totems to get those Roar modifiers.
    - (Unmarked?) quest to gather ingredients for werebear cure
    - New sounds for werebear roars. (from vanilla skyrim bears? maybe an edited version of them, lower pitch?)
    - if you go to cure yourself at the end of Companions quest as a werebear, a bear should spawn instead of a wolf.
    - 'mystic hunter' perk: plus damage to undead and werebeasts (i.e add silver keyword to claws)
    - forced transformation during full moon, variable chance other nights depending on moon phase, give player a warning a few minutes before... "You start to feel uneasy."

    Spitballing some ideas: Thematically, bears are seen as tough and enduring, over a wolf's speed and ferocity. They also tend to be solitary, compared to a wolf pack, and don't quite have the association with howls that a wolf does.

    So following that, I'd imagine that the werebear is more about damage resistance than damage output. Increased armor, frost resistance (thick fur), health bonus, etc. Slower speed than a werewolf, but you remain transformed longer. A knockback/stagger power attack? Something to make it feel like you are hitting hard, rather than the vicious clawing and eating of a werewolf.

    Shouts would be called Growls rather than Howls. I'm unsure on whether there would be a summoning howl, as that gives the feeling of a pack. Perhaps a "hibernate" themed ability instead, where you can regain health. A fear growl is fine, as they definitely do that in game, but I'd assume a lesser radius due to not "howling at the moon."

      Maybe the growls could focus on area debuffs / cloaks as opposed to the werewolfs utility and summons?

      Something like:

      Growl of Might: Delivers a stagger to enemies around the player and throws enemies in melee range off their feet.
      Growl of Despair: Prevents magicka and stamina regeneration of enemies around the player. 

      The flavor and theme of the perknames could also center around werebears as less aggressively nimble and more of a crude, slow and seething terror than werewolves.
      Think "Brutality", "Boulderhide", "Primal Hatred", "Battering Ram", "Butcher", etc.
